The students, many of whom are from Eastern Kentucky, get to ferret out a range of possible experiences, said Kathryn Engle, director of the Appalachian Center and adjunct assistant professor of sociology.
WebOct 10, 2024 · The story of the blue-skinned Kentucky people began in 1820 when Martin Fugate, a French orphan, settled in the wilds of Eastern Kentucky to claim a land grant near Troublesome Creek. ... “Pap” would occasionally see them when they left their isolation in the “hollers.” Perhaps they were visiting Pap’s general store to purchase ...
